Heat wave conditions in 71 mandals

April 03, 2016 12:00 am | Updated 05:42 am IST - VIJAYAWADA

: Heat wave conditions prevailed in 71 of the 670 mandals in the last 24 hours in the State, according to the IMD AWS data made available on Saturday night.

According to the analysis based on humidity and maximum recorded temperature, normal conditions are predicted in most of the mandals, warm conditions in 18 mandals, but “very hot” or “hot” conditions will not prevail in any of the 670 mandals in the next 48 hours.

Till date, 29 heat stroke-related deaths have been reported by District Collectors. The number of deaths in different districts is: Kadapa 12, Prakasam 11, Kurnool 3, Srikakulam 2 and Anantapur 1.
